How to Cultivate Salice Roses
Cultivating Salice roses requires attention to detail and a passion for gardening. Here are some essential tips to help you grow these beautiful flowers:
Choosing the Right Location
Salice roses thrive in areas with ample sunlight and well-drained soil. Ensure that your garden receives at least 6-8 hours of sunlight daily.
Planting Process
Follow these steps to plant Salice roses:
- Dig a hole twice as wide as the root ball.
- Mix organic compost into the soil to enhance nutrient content.
- Place the rose plant in the hole and backfill with soil.
- Water thoroughly after planting.
Seasonal Care
During the growing season, prune the plants regularly to encourage healthy growth. In winter, protect the roots with mulch to prevent frost damage.
Care and Maintenance Tips
To ensure your Salice roses remain vibrant and healthy, follow these care tips:
- Watering: Water the plants deeply once a week, ensuring the soil remains moist but not waterlogged.
- Fertilizing: Use a balanced fertilizer every 4-6 weeks during the growing season.
- Pest Control: Inspect the plants regularly for signs of pests and treat them with organic solutions if necessary.
By providing proper care, you can enjoy the beauty of Salice roses for years to come.
